titleOfInvention |
Method for testing for allergic disease |
abstract |
An objective of the present invention is to provide a method for testing for an allergic disease and a method of screening for a therapeutic agent for allergic diseases. n MAL was identified as a gene the expression level of which is significantly increased in T cells contained in the peripheral blood monocyte (PBMC) upon stimulation thereof with a mite allergen in vitro. The present inventors found that this gene can be used in testing for allergic diseases and in screening for agents and compounds useful in the treatment of allergic diseases. |
